Odd Audio Reverb/tapping/effect on g930

Hi, I recently got  the G930 headset, I'm rather liking it but I'm finding I'm ocassioanly hearing an odd effect on certain noises.

 

Some audio (or in some cases, speech) is followed or accented by a strange reverb or almost electric tapping or sometimes crackling sort of sound.  Its fairly quiet but enough to be annoying.

 

I cant think of a very realiable way to make it crop up, but seems to be (or at least noticable) on shoter, queiter sounds. It seems to happen regardless if the headset is plugged in or not,  It also seems to happen wether or not the mic is muted. I also have the sidetone set to 0.
